What Is a Baby Bed Cot?
A baby bed cot, commonly described as a baby crib or cot, is a little bed created for infants and children. These beds are usually confined with high sides and are crafted from tough products to make sure safety during sleep. Baby cots can be found in different design and styles to match any nursery decor, and they come equipped with features that improve convenience and safety.
Kinds Of Baby Bed Cots
Selecting the best type of baby cot can be overwhelming. Below is a table summing up the different designs of baby cots offered in the market.
| Type | Description | Pros | Cons |
|---|---|---|---|
| Requirement Crib | A conventional baby crib, typically created for long-term use. | Tough, safe, and durable; appropriate for infants and toddlers. | Uses up more space; may not transform to other bed styles. |
| Convertible Crib | A baby crib that can be transformed into a young child bed or daybed. | Lasting investment; versatile style. | Higher initial expense; may require extra purchases later on. |
| Portable Crib | Lightweight and collapsible, perfect for travel or small spaces. | Easy to carry; great for travel or small homes. | Might not be as tough as standard cribs; minimal functions. |
| Moses Basket | A small, portable basket developed for newborns. | Highly portable; relaxing for babies. | Limited use time; less long lasting than a baby crib. |
| Co-Sleeper | Connects to the side of the moms and dads' bed for simple gain access to. | Promotes bonding; reduces risks of SIDS when used properly. | Minimal space; not ideal for big beds. |
Key Features to Consider
When picking a baby bed cot, several essential features must be taken into consideration:
Safety Standards: Ensure the cot satisfies safety regulations. Try to find certifications from the Consumer Product Safety Commission (CPSC) in the U.S. or equivalent firms in other regions.
Product Quality: Opt for cots made from solid wood or top quality products that are devoid of damaging chemicals.
Adjustable Mattress Height: Cots with adjustable mattress heights can accommodate your growing baby, making it simpler to raise them in and out safely.
Stability and Durability: A steady cot will make sure that your baby's movements do not trigger the cot to wobble or tip.
Ease of Assembly: Some cots require assembly, so check out evaluations to make sure the procedure is uncomplicated.
Mattress Quality: A great bed mattress is vital for your baby's sleep. Try to find a firm bed mattress made particularly for infants.
Safety Tips for Using Baby Bed Cots
Security is paramount when it concerns baby cots. Here are some crucial safety pointers for ensuring a safe sleeping environment for your baby:
Always use a fitted sheet: Use just fitted sheets that are particularly designed for the crib mattress size to prevent suffocation threats.
Avoid soft bed linen: Keep pillows, blankets, and packed toys out of the crib, as they present a suffocation risk.
Check for remembers: Regularly check if your cot has been recalled by the maker for safety reasons.
Establish the crib far from hazards: Ensure the crib is not near windows, drapes, or hanging objects that could be taken down.
Frequently inspect the cot: Routinely inspect for loose screws or any damage to the cot.
Frequently Asked Questions About Baby Bed Cots
At what age can my baby start using a cot?
- Many infants can start using a cot from birth. Nevertheless, some portable cots are designed specifically for babies.
What is the perfect bed mattress firmness for an infant?
- The bed mattress should be firm and flat, offering sufficient assistance to reduce the danger of SIDS (Sudden Infant Death Syndrome).
The length of time can my baby use a crib?
- A lot of baby cribs can be utilized until your child has to do with 3 years of ages, although convertible cribs can last longer as they are developed to transition to young child beds.
Is it safe to use pre-owned baby cribs?
- Purchasing second-hand cribs can be safe, but it's necessary to ensure they abide by current safety requirements and have not been recalled.
What's the distinction in between a cot and a baby crib?
- The terms "cot" and "crib" can refer to the exact same product depending upon local preferences. In the UK, "cot" is commonly used, while "baby crib" is more common in the U.S.
